Common Grass Replacement Jobs
Grass Replacement services involve removing damaged or worn turf and installing fresh grass to improve lawn appearance.
Resodding provides a quick way to restore a patchy or thinning lawn with new sod sections.
Seeding offers an option for establishing new grass in areas where sod isn't suitable or desired.
Patch Repair addresses specific damaged spots to seamlessly blend new grass with existing turf.
Artificial Grass Installation provides a low-maintenance alternative to natural grass for a lush, green look year-round.
Lawn Renovation combines multiple techniques to revitalize and enhance overall lawn health and aesthetics.
Grass Replacement Questions
What types of grass can be replaced? Common options include Bermuda, fescue, and Kentucky bluegrass, suitable for different lawn conditions and preferences.
When is the best time for grass replacement? The optimal time is during the active growing season, typically in spring or early fall, for best establishment.
What should property owners consider before replacing grass? It’s important to evaluate soil condition, sunlight exposure, and water needs to select the most suitable grass type.
Are there different methods for grass replacement? Yes, options include sod installation, seed planting, or turf rolls, depending on the project scope and desired results.
